Sql Server Database Administrator Resume
Rockville, MD
SUMMARY:
- SQL Server Database Administrator with versions from 7 to 2016, supporting company databases 24X7 in mid - size datacenter (26 database servers, over 200 databases). Maintain Recovery Time Objectives and Recovery Point
- Objectives for each database. Implement and maintain successful database environment, including SSIS integrations. Schedule and monitor of SQL Server jobs, SSAS, Reporting Services maintenance, install and support of back end of 3rd party tools. Establish policies and procedures pertaining to production, testing, and development groups. Good team player and autonomous problem solver.

PROFESSIONAL EXPERIENCE:
Confidential, Rockville, MD
SQL Server Database Administrator
Tools: SQL Server, Red-Gate SQL Compare, Litespeed, Solarwinds DPA, Reporting Server, SSIS, ETL, SSAS, Postie, Robocopy, Oracle,VBScript.
Responsibilities:
- Responsible for 24X7 support of High Availability SQL Clusters and stand - alone servers running SQL Server databases on rotational basis.
- Monitor and maintain production MS SQL Server environment. Track and resolve database related requestsfulfill incidents, review service related reports (performance tuning, user privilege changes, custom backups, ad hoc data extracts, database synchronization to dev\test groups) on a daily basis to ensure service related issues are identifying and resolving issues, responding to database related alerts and escalations and work with different departments within the company to come up with strategic solutions to mitigate recurring problems.
- Collaborate with developers and testers in implementation of fast and flawless deployments.
- Write detailed operational database related documentation and specifications.
- Administer user profiles, user rights, security policies
- Schedule and monitor SQL Server jobs to automate integrations and maintenance packages.
- Setup tracing and audit procedures
- Improve procedure performance, tuning databases.
- Monitor database capacity issues, replication, and other distributed data problems
- Rebuild / monitor indexes at regular intervals for better performance
- Develop backup systems, data transfer and migration between different systems
- Migrate SQL databases from legacy systems to new environments.
- Data import/export ( ETL ) from other systems into SQL Server with SSIS and DTS.
- Generate report for management presentations
- Archive historical data, monitor health of databases
- Monitor SQL job logs to identify success or failures; troubleshoot and debug database related issues.
- Monitor and maintain database disk space.
- Backup and restore of databases
- Support database environments for DevOps and testers, set automated refresh from production
- Install and configure database part of 3rd party software on dev/test prod servers
- Plan and implement disaster recovery: log shipping, mirroring, replication
- Patch database servers
- Work with IT Network specialists to set High Availability (HA) and Disaster Recovery (DR) options for MSSQL Server.
